Output 24a23091083616740a1d77096f871340a225d4dc2067169d84e220b128e7b4fa:0

value
99799886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58c247508d95cf2de6c22a3857de4d534bb4b8f6 OP_EQUALVERIFY OP_CHECKSIG
address
LTKGTohac1XwvahTqJEEUNouaFxoFud7Cg
transaction
24a23091083616740a1d77096f871340a225d4dc2067169d84e220b128e7b4fa
spent
true